Bio-Dominance refers to a physiological state where one or more biological compounds, particularly hormones, exert an excessive influence or activity relative to others within a systemic framework, leading to a functional imbalance. This condition signifies an overrepresentation or heightened effect of specific biological agents, disrupting the delicate regulatory mechanisms that govern optimal health and cellular function.
Context
Within the human body, Bio-Dominance typically operates within the endocrine system, where the complex interplay of hormones, receptors, and feedback loops dictates cellular responses and systemic regulation. It can manifest when a particular hormone’s production is consistently elevated, its metabolic clearance is impaired, or target tissue receptors exhibit increased sensitivity, thereby skewing the normal hormonal milieu and impacting downstream pathways.
Significance
The clinical significance of Bio-Dominance is considerable, as it frequently underlies a spectrum of symptoms and chronic health conditions, impacting patient well-being. Identifying this state is crucial for accurate diagnosis, guiding therapeutic strategies, and predicting potential health trajectories, as it directly influences symptomatic presentation and long-term physiological outcomes.
Mechanism
At a mechanistic level, Bio-Dominance often involves an altered ratio of specific compounds, such as an elevated estrogen-to-progesterone ratio, or sustained activation of particular receptor pathways. This can result from endogenous overproduction, exogenous compound exposure, or compromised detoxification processes, leading to prolonged stimulation of target cells and tissues beyond physiological thresholds.
Application
In clinical practice, understanding Bio-Dominance is applied to address conditions like premenstrual dysphoric disorder, uterine fibroids, and certain hormone-sensitive cancers, where targeted interventions aim to restore physiological equilibrium. Management protocols may involve dietary modifications, specific nutritional support, or pharmaceutical agents designed to modulate hormone production, receptor activity, or metabolic clearance pathways.
Metric
Measuring the extent of Bio-Dominance involves comprehensive assessment through various clinical metrics, including serum, salivary, or urinary hormone panels that quantify parent hormones and their metabolites. Additionally, symptomatic questionnaires and physical examination findings provide valuable correlative data, helping to construct a complete clinical picture of the imbalance.
Risk
Improperly managing or failing to address Bio-Dominance carries inherent risks, including the exacerbation of existing symptoms, progression of hormone-sensitive pathologies, and the potential for adverse effects from misdirected therapeutic interventions. Unsupervised or inappropriate attempts to correct these imbalances can further disrupt physiological systems, underscoring the necessity of professional medical guidance.
